The cheapest way to get from Warboys to Ely is to drive which costs £4 - £7 and takes 24 min.
The fastest way to get from Warboys to Ely is to drive which takes 24 min and costs £4 - £7.
No, there is no direct bus from Warboys to Ely. However, there are services departing from Goldpits and arriving at Market Street via East Park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 40m.
The distance between Warboys and Ely is 23 miles. The road distance is 18.9 miles.
The best way to get from Warboys to Ely without a car is to line 302 bus and bus which takes 1h 40m and costs .
It takes approximately 1h 40m to get from Warboys to Ely, including transfers.
Warboys to Ely bus services, operated by Dews Coaches, depart from Goldpits station.
Warboys to Ely bus services, operated by Dews Coaches, arrive at East Park Street station.
Yes, the driving distance between Warboys to Ely is 19 miles. It takes approximately 24 min to drive from Warboys to Ely.
